AUT Journal of Mathematics and Computing (AUT J Math Comput) is a double-blind peer-reviewed quarterly journal, owned, managed, and published by Amirkabir University of Technology since 2020 and is indexed in Scopus. The journal publish novel reputable original articles, review articles and short communications in the fields of mathematical science including, pure mathematics, applied mathematics, computer science and statistics. The journal changed its publication frequency to quarterly from early 2024.
